This clinic is appropriate for both new and existing volunteers. An orientation for new volunteers will take place 1.5 hours prior to the start of this clinic. New volunteers will receive a separate notice about the orientation from our Volunteer Coordinator, Bill Prout.

The goal of the sidewalker/horse leader clinic is to make your role here more rewarding and allow us to maintain the high standards we strive for as a NARHA Premier Accredited Center.

The sidewalker clinic will go into every aspect of correct sidewalking methodology. We will explore the physical aspect of working with our riders, as well as perform emergency dismounts. The clinic also addresses how sidewalking relates to the behavioral aspects of our riders and rider/volunteer interaction.

The horse leader clinic will be a practical, hands-on workshop in which we will work directly with our horses, address specific problems and standardize the way we approach our horse-leading practices at Pegasus. You will be working with other volunteers under the direction of our instructor staff.
